USPS to replace First Class Package, Retail Ground, Parcel Select with Ground Advantage Summer 2023

As USPS implements price & service changes every July (think the first year was August), I expect that's about the time they're planning to roll this out.

 

https://postalnews.com/blog/2023/02/10/usps-seeks-to-replace-first-class-package-service-with-usps-g...

 

WASHINGTON, Feb. 10, 2023 /PRNewswire/ — As part of its overall strategy to enhance its shipping offerings, the United States Postal Service today filed a procedural filing with the Postal Regulatory Commission (PRC) notifying the commission of the Postal Service’s intention to replace its existing First-Class Package Service category with USPS Ground Advantage. USPS Ground Advantage will feature two-to five day service standards for packages up to 70 pounds.

 

The filing streamlines and simplifies package shipping options for customers and enhances the Postal Service’s ground product offering with the anticipated summer 2023 launch of its improved ground product — USPS Ground Advantage.

USPS to replace First Class Package, Retail Ground, Parcel Select with Ground Advantage Summer 2023

I'm not really worried about it. With Reg Rate they converted to regular Priority so calculated shipping was unaffected and (as usual) anybody using flat rate or free ship had to manage the rates manually.

 

So I assume for this FCP will convert to GA or GRAD or whatever you want to call it. Retail Ground will also convert. Should be pretty seamless.

 

Parcel Select will be interesting to see how sellers react. What I assume will happen is it will be a straight conversion, and whether online or retail rates show will depend on the seller's shipping preferences. So if those sellers want to offer commercial rates they'll have to change their settings to offer online discounts for all USPS services - or switch to flat rate / rate tables. They will no longer be able to charge retail rates for all other services and commercial rates for ground service.

 

It's a little weird since USPS had Retail Ground and Parcel Select split up; that split never made sense to me. If those services had the same name with a retail/commercial split like every other service this wouldn't even be in question.
